Clean Burning

A wood stove burns wood and produces heat, but it also releases particulates and gases into the air. In certain regions it can cause poor air quality, which can affect our health and well-being. This is why it is essential to make use of clean burning technology for your wood stove.

If you own a brand modern, contemporary wood stove equipped with Clean Burn technology, it dramatically reduces airborne dust and particulate emissions. This will not only make your home more healthy and more comfortable, but it will also save money since you will get more warmth from each log.

ECO stoves currently have one of the strictest emission requirements in the world. They can emit just 5 grams of particles per kilo of best small wood burning stove burned. A modern stove has many ways to improve the combustion of the wood. It is important to monitor the flow of air and slow down the airflow when the fire has become hot and stable - else you could end up killing the fire.

Cleaner burning stoves also produce less creosote. This is a sticky substance that builds up on the inside of the chimney. It can pose a serious fire risk. The reduced production of creosote will also help you save time and money on chimney sweeping costs.

The pre-heated air in our new wood stoves is another key factor in their top-level performance. This is a different level of air that is added above the fuel load, and helps ensure that all particles are completely ignited. Eco-Friendly

Wood burners are a low carbon alternative to stoves made of fossil fuels. Trees absorb carbon dioxide from the atmosphere and release it back when they are burnt as part of the closed CO2 cycle. This process is less harmful to the environment than releasing carbon dioxide into the air when using oil, gas or electricity to heat your home.

Modern stoves are greater efficiency than earlier models, which means that you can heat your home using much less firewood. Some models are so efficient that they release virtually no smoke, generate minimal ash and require 70% less logs than traditional stoves. While wood burning woodburning stoves near me emit fewer emissions than other stoves, they produce fine particulate pollution. These tiny, harmful particles can penetrate deep into the lungs and can be extremely harmful to your health. The independent body that sets standards for heating appliances HETAS has been leading a campaign to improve wood stoves so that they minimize this kind of pollution as much as is possible and a lot of manufacturers are working on eco-friendly wood burners that are compliant with the most recent standards.
